Safety Considerations
When it comes to pharmaceutical packaging, safety is paramount. I often think about how the materials we choose can impact the integrity of the medicines we package. Two critical aspects to consider are chemical stability and contamination risks.
Chemical Stability
Aluminum slugs for pharmaceutical packaging offer exceptional chemical stability. They resist corrosion and do not react with the contents they hold. This stability is crucial for maintaining the efficacy of medications. In contrast, plastic containers can sometimes leach chemicals into their contents, especially when exposed to heat or light. This leaching can compromise the safety and effectiveness of the drugs.
To illustrate the differences in safety standards, here’s a quick comparison:
| Property | Aluminum Slugs | Plastic Containers |
|---|---|---|
| Barrier Protection | Exceptional barrier protection | Moderate protection |
| Oxygen Transmission Rate | Below 0.1 cc/m²/day | Not specified |
| Moisture Vapor Transmission Rate | Below 0.05 g/m²/day | Not specified |
| Opacity to UV and Visible Light | Complete opacity | Not specified |
| Controlled Elastic Collapse | Prevents air backflow | Not applicable |
As you can see, aluminum slugs provide superior barrier protection. They keep out moisture and oxygen, which can degrade pharmaceutical products. This level of protection is vital for ensuring that medications remain safe and effective throughout their shelf life.

Sustainability Factors

When I think about sustainability in pharmaceutical packaging, recyclability and environmental impact come to mind. These factors play a significant role in my decision-making process when choosing between aluminum slugs and plastic.
Recyclability
One of the standout features of aluminum slugs is their recyclability. I find it impressive that aluminum cans boast a global recycling rate of 71%. This high rate means that most aluminum products can be recycled efficiently. In contrast, plastic bottles only have a recycling rate of 40%. This disparity highlights how aluminum slugs can contribute to a more sustainable future.
Here’s a quick comparison of recycling rates:
| Material | Global Recycling Rate (%) | Additional Notes |
|---|---|---|
| Aluminum cans | 71 | Highest recycling rate globally; 90% recycling efficiency; 98% recycled into recyclable products |
| Plastic bottles | 40 | Much lower recycling rate; only 14-18% of plastic waste recycled globally; only 9% of all plastics ever made have been recycled |
I appreciate that aluminum can be recycled multiple times without losing its quality. This means that when I choose aluminum slugs for packaging, I’m not just making a choice for today; I’m also considering the future.
Environmental Impact
The environmental impact of packaging materials is another crucial factor. I’ve learned that producing aluminum slugs from recycled materials significantly lowers carbon emissions compared to traditional aluminum production. In fact, using recycled aluminum can save up to 95% of the energy needed to create aluminum from raw materials. This reduction directly decreases the carbon footprint associated with the production process.
In contrast, plastic production often involves higher energy consumption and contributes to more greenhouse gas emissions. Compatibility with Pharmaceutical Products

When I consider the compatibility of packaging materials with pharmaceutical products, two key factors come to mind: barrier properties and shelf life extension. These aspects are crucial for ensuring that medications remain effective and safe for consumers.
Barrier Properties
Aluminum slugs for pharmaceutical packaging offer exceptional barrier properties. They provide a nearly complete shield against moisture, light, and oxygen. This is vital because exposure to these elements can degrade the quality of medications. In fact, aluminum packaging, especially in the form of cold forming blister foil, significantly outperforms plastic in this regard.
Here’s a quick comparison of barrier properties:
| Property | Aluminum Slug Packaging | Plastic Packaging |
|---|---|---|
| Moisture Resistance | Superior | Moderate |
| Oxygen Resistance | Superior | Moderate |
| Light Protection | Yes | No |
| Microbial Barrier | Yes | Limited |
| Drug Stability | High | Variable |
I find it reassuring that aluminum slugs can effectively block moisture and oxygen, ensuring that the medications I package remain stable and safe. This level of protection is something I can't overlook when choosing packaging materials.
Shelf Life Extension
Another significant advantage of aluminum slugs is their ability to extend the shelf life of pharmaceutical products. The airtight and lightproof nature of aluminum packaging helps maintain the integrity of the contents over time. In contrast, plastic is permeable to light and air, which can lead to a shorter shelf life for products.
The benefits of aluminum packaging include:
- Corrosion Resistance: It effectively protects contents and extends shelf life.
- Light Blocking: Prevents deterioration caused by light exposure.
- Excellent Barrier: Blocks moisture, oxygen, odors, and bacteria.
